Transaction 3568f912144c21736cee03134a97283a14897f0e36e32f5bef067c4fc20399fe
1 Input
1 Output
-
3568f912144c21736cee03134a97283a14897f0e36e32f5bef067c4fc20399fe:0
- value
- 240639
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f89db0cc396694759d67b6405c3615546afd98ba OP_EQUAL
- address
- 3QMaQescbqJg5Aq6fMbbdacFR3C3FTfHYh